GOVERNMENT has commissioned and handed over seven Constituency Development Fund (CDF) projects valued at over K7.5 million in Isoka District. The commissioned projects include the National Assembly Office, Chizongolo Health Post, Malale Health Post, Nazareth Health Post, a 1×3 classroom block at Mweninkasi Primary School, and other community infrastructure funded under the Constituency Development Fund. The projects were officially commissioned by Muchinga Province Permanent Secretary Tuesday Bwalya during a ceremony held at the newly constructed National Assembly Office in Isoka.
